Output 8021dd758c4fd21d1ad58b16403042d58d3a268e3717fd40b0aacf4ecbc1a647:19

value
18856841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0d2146af556cbb0f284597b6d3b3f7b66215ab5 OP_EQUAL
address
3GMMhqKxDn1fpqkM7HUUaK4LqdekgZpPvj
transaction
8021dd758c4fd21d1ad58b16403042d58d3a268e3717fd40b0aacf4ecbc1a647
spent
true